If you have typed "Windows 31 APK" into a search engine, you are likely part of a unique crossover between two distinct eras of computing. On one hand, you have Windows 3.1—the iconic graphical interface from 1992 that transformed MS-DOS into a point-and-click operating system. On the other hand, you have the APK (Android Package Kit)—the modern file format used to distribute apps on smartphones. Vaporwave & Memes: The OS is filled with
The immediate technical answer is simple: There is no official "Windows 3.1 APK." Microsoft never released a version of Windows 3.1 that runs natively on Android.
